What is a Chi-Squared test?

A

Chi-Squared is a test of difference or association. The data are nominal and recorded as frequencies.

What is the key feature of Chi-Squared?

A

Each data item is not listed separately but instead recorded in a frequency count in a contingency table

What are the requirements for the data in a Chi-Squared test?

A

The data must be independent, meaning each data point must represent a different person.

What does it mean if χ² is significant?

A

The null hypothesis is rejected, and the alternative hypothesis is supported.
